Zahid, a native of India and self-described “disruptor” of industry is an entrepreneur par excellence. Over the past years, Zahid has evolved from a studious teen, who passed high school from Jamshedpur, graduated from Aligarh Muslim University and later on he completed his MBA from Sikkim Manipal University. He came to the Middle East to use his expertise as a chief programmer in Saudi Electricity Company in 2001. Zahid believes that Behind every prosperous entrepreneur is a scrambled record: a lifetime of mounting successes and dreadful failures and the ever-present motivation to keep pushing boundaries. His inner urge pulled him towards business and he started his business career with just one hundred Saudi riyal. He then tendered small contracts from the government and pushed into the business with force, wit, and sheer determination. He has proudly engaged a man power of over 4000 and expects this to increase manifold, a small estimation of which is around 17000 by the end of 2020. His entrepreneurship extends in different realms—facility management, hospitality services, general trading, energy, mining, education, transportation, construction and real estate, jewelry and many other fields. He has been successfully managing hotels with over 20,000 rooms combined. His formidable presence can be felt in the entire Middle East ranging from Saudi Arabia, Bahrain, Oman Qatar and UAE. His company is among the top four ISO certified facility management company of KSA with multi million dollar turnover. The company envisages to double its turnover by 2020. His business acumen shall soon be witnessed in the food and beverage industry where he expects to give still competition to existing food chain investors soon. He has already started to set his foot in the Indian hospitality industry as well.
